  • Patent number: 6790053
    Abstract: An electrical connector includes a molded plastic housing having an elongated body portion defining a front mating face and a rear terminating face of the connector. A plurality of terminal-receiving passages are defined by walls extending between the mating and terminating faces. The walls are of generally uniform thickness between the faces to provide an even flow pattern for the plastic material of which the housing is molded. A plurality of conductive terminals are mounted in the terminal-receiving passages.

  • Patent number: 6672884
    Abstract: An electrical connector includes a dielectric housing of molded plastic material having a plurality of elongated terminal-receiving passages into which a plurality of terminals are inserted through a terminal-insertion face of the housing. At least two of the elongated terminal-receiving passages are adjacent to each other and have elongated side walls providing elongated guide surfaces for inserting the terminals. The elongated side walls of each of the passages is open at a side thereof near the other passage along a substantial length thereof to provide communication between the passages for a single core pin to be used in forming the passages during molding of the housing.

  • Patent number: 6345992
    Abstract: An electrical connector 10 is mountable on a surface of a printed circuit board 11. Connector 10 includes an elongated dielectric housing 12 having a central body portion 12a with a front mating face 16a, a lower face 23 and a plurality of terminal-receiving passages 19 extending therebetween. A plurality of terminals 20 are received in passages 19. Each terminal 20 includes a forward contact portion 21 and a tail portion 22 projecting from a body portion 12a of terminal 20 beyond lower face 23 of housing 12. Tail portions 22 include angled sections 22a for surface mounting on printed circuit board 11. An elongated tail aligner 32 is fixed to housing 12 spaced from lower face 23 thereof. Tail aligner 32 has a plurality of apertures 34 through which tail portions 22 of terminals 20 extend.
